#include <bits/stdc++.h>
#define int long long
#define pii pair<int, int>
#define pb push_back
#define gcd __gcd
#define endl "\n"
#define task "hihi"
using namespace std;
const int N = 2000 + 5, MOD = 1e9 + 7, INF = 1e18 + 5; 
int s, n, dp[N];
vector<array<int, 3>> items; 
vector<pii> need[N];
vector<pii> fin;
signed main(){
    ios_base::sync_with_stdio(0);
    cin.tie(0);
    //freopen(task".inp", "r", stdin);
    //freopen(task".out", "w", stdout);
    cin >> s >> n;
    for(int i = 1; i <= n; i++){
        int v, w, k; cin >> v >> w >> k;
        k = min(k, s / w);
        need[w].pb({v, k});
        items.pb({v, w, k});
    }
    for(int i = 1; i <= s; i++){
        sort(need[i].begin(), need[i].end());
        int ntt = s / i;
        for(pii x : need[i]){
            int taken = min(ntt, x.second);
            for(int j = 1; j <= taken; j++){
                fin.pb({i, x.first});
            }
            ntt -= x.second;
            if(ntt <= 0) break;
        }   
    }
    for(int i = 1; i <= s; i++) dp[i] = -INF;
    int ans = 0;
    for(int i = 0; i < fin.size(); i++){
        for(int j = s; j >= fin[i].first; j--){
            dp[j] = max(dp[j], dp[j - fin[i].first] + fin[i].second);
            ans = max(ans, dp[j]);
        }
    }
    cout << ans << endl;
    return 0;
}
